Publisher's Synopsis

The way of our Lord and His teachings are quite plain, as they have come down to us in the Bible. So why have the acquisition of a "mega-church", acres of real estate and property, and a television following become more important? Why do ministers of religion allow themselves to get diverted into political activities that contradict their original calling? In his investigation into the present state of Christian practice in America, Chidera Michaels finds out how much Christianity has increasingly become a religion of convenience that allows its practitioners to propagate their own, separate, ideological agendas. His message to all Christians is a vital one, never more so than now: Christianity will not regain the respect it once had unless its ministers return to the uncompromising way of life that is beyond greed, ambition and politics.
